The Nikon 18-70mm f/3.5-4.5 G ED-IF AF-S DX lives up to all of its letters.

by   jvandegr , top reviewer in Electronics at Epinions.com ,  Mar 27, 2006
Pros: Fast focus, very good optical quality, useful zoom range, compact, low weight, affordable.
Cons: Zoom lens movement is not smooth, some vignetting at large apertures.
The Bottom Line: Easy to recommend for its great price-to-performance ratio. Very good optical quality, fast focus, good build quality, and a useful zoom range. Much better than the average "kit" zoom lens.

a "kit lens" or the real deal?

by   uniq , top reviewer in Electronics at Epinions.com ,  Mar 19, 2005
Pros: All the "pro" level OPTICAL features, fantastic price/performance ratio
Cons: 67mm filter size, plastic construction, variable aperture, DX designation, focus ring in BACK?
The Bottom Line: it is a great companion to the D70 and ideally suited to those users who are looking for great optical performance but aren't rich.
